Job Overview

University Hospital Southampton NHS Foundation Trust is delighted to offer a fantastic opportunity to work with us.

University Hospital Southampton NHS Foundation Trust is delighted to offer a fantastic opportunity to work with us. Please see below for the detailed job description of the role. Main duties of the job. We are excited to offer an opportunity for an innovative and analytical Project Manager to join our team. This is a role focused on data and metrics management, analysis and the preparation of reports on the NIHR Southampton Biomedical Research Centre's performance metrics, alongside identifying opportunities to improve efficiency through digital innovation and Artificial Intelligence (AI). You will play a key role in ensuring the delivery of high-quality reporting to the National Institute for Health and Care Research (NIHR) and other stakeholders, turning complex data into insights that inform decision-making. Working closely with operational, research and senior leadership teams, you will lead initiatives that strengthen performance monitoring, streamline reporting processes and help shape new ways of working through the adoption of AI-enabled tools and solutions. This is an exciting opportunity for someone who enjoys combining analytical thinking, project management and innovation to deliver measurable improvements. Person specification
Qualifications, Knowledge And Experience

Essential criteria

  • Relevant Batchelor Degree (Tech, Business, Change) or equivalent specialist knowledge and experience
  • Masters or equivalent specialist knowledge and experience
  • Recognised Project Management qualification to practitioner level or equivalent experience
  • Knowledge and practical experience of the management and successful delivery of full project lifecycle (including pre-project phases) of medium projects.
  • Experience of analysing complex datasets and producing reports, dashboards and performance information to internal and external groups
  • Proven knowledge and practical experience in the development, management, and maintenance of databases, ensuring data integrity and usability.
  • Project management skills including use of multiple methodologies e.g., waterfall and agile.
  • Knowledge of the creation, review, update and reporting of standard project artefacts.
  • Knowledge of how to analyse complex technical information relating to programmes and present to a variety of audiences.
  • Knowledge of how to identify, source, assimilate and apply relevant (clinical, system, setting) specific and technical knowledge
  • Knowledge of how to identify complex project risks and issues and develop detailed mitigation strategies
  • Understanding of relevant legislation and guidance

Desirable criteria

  • Recognised relevant change management qualifications e.g., relating to risk, benefits, change, business analysis, or continuous improvement
  • Other project and change management training courses
  • Recognised Project Management qualification to practitioner level or equivalent experience Staff management training courses
  • Management and successful delivery of full project lifecycle of medium, small and very small change projects (including pre-project phases) in an Acute NHS Trust, a provider NHS (non-acute) or the NHS.
  • Evidence of recent further professional development
